China Hong Kong Hong Kong Tencent Cloud
Websites on 43.154.4.174
- Domain names that have been bound:
- 2022-05-14-----2022-05-14freshfocusvideo.com
- website server lookup history
- 60688jc.com
- 186666.com
- 81115.com
- www.pxmujq.com
- xiangcaoyun.com
- zxs9nj.com
- wd699.com
- 982112.com
- w2.las6688.com
- tongzhouhuanbaokeji.com
- 288.com
- xxxjapanclips.com
- huizuoban.com
- see.cxfcl.com
- www.truongbaoxuan.com
- bh166.top
- zf228.top
- m5.m579a011.cc
- vg788.top
- 12378kf.com
- hosting ip address lookup history
- 154.216.44.174
- 103.38.20.196
- 95.65.115.161
- 176.122.152.105
- 119.84.240.9
- 176.122.152.130
- 104.17.35.110
- 92.118.205.120
- 103.113.8.227
- 24.49.128.9
- 23.229.53.51
- 38.106.19.253
- 23.50.142.98
- 104.206.85.160
- 20.205.14.242
- 45.15.128.59
- 34.197.15.114
- 211.83.176.112
- 183.225.19.1
- 161.202.150.200
